Solution for 12-7x=2x+18 equation:


Simplifying
12 + -7x = 2x + 18

Reorder the terms:
12 + -7x = 18 + 2x

Solving
12 + -7x = 18 + 2x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-2x' to each side of the equation.
12 + -7x + -2x = 18 + 2x + -2x

Combine like terms: -7x + -2x = -9x
12 + -9x = 18 + 2x + -2x

Combine like terms: 2x + -2x = 0
12 + -9x = 18 + 0
12 + -9x = 18

Add '-12' to each side of the equation.
12 + -12 + -9x = 18 + -12

Combine like terms: 12 + -12 = 0
0 + -9x = 18 + -12
-9x = 18 + -12

Combine like terms: 18 + -12 = 6
-9x = 6

Divide each side by '-9'.
x = -0.6666666667

Simplifying
x = -0.6666666667
